La Lutte Continue (the struggle continues)

France - 1968
26 x 41 in (66 x 104 cm)
ID #101082


The fight continues 

Printed by Personality Posters Mfg.Co. Inc in 1968 they printed all types of posters

lots of stuff for head shops and black light posters

